对称三进制在椭圆曲线标量乘法中的应用
Application of Balanced Ternary in Elliptic Curve Scalar Multiplication

Abstract
Recoding k and direct computing kp by introducing the balanced ternary to scalar multiplication can improve its efficiency. This paper gives an algorithm which recodes k as balanced ternary string, and proposes a balanced ternary algorithm to scalar multiplication. In this case, the average efficiency is improved 5.4% relative to the binary algorithm. When precomputation is used, the average efficiency is improved 73.18% and 15.58% relative to the algorithm which uses binary and binary precomputation, and the accounts which need to store is declined observably.关键词
